Claiming children

I have 2 children with my domestic partner. We both live together with the children. I make around 125,000 a year and she is around 50,000 a year. I claim head of household since I pay over 50 % of all the bills. I have claimed the children on my tax returns in the past, should I continue to claim them on this years tax filings or should she ? Wanting to know which return would be greater when it comes to the child tax credits ? We also pay around 15,000 a year in child care.

Claiming children

The only way to answer that question is to complete your separate returns both ways ...   if you are not legally married and the children are considered your child according to tax law definitions then you can put the kids on the return making the most sense.  Of course with your high income the kids are worth more to you along with the HOH filing status.
